What fitted sheet size do you need for a 200x210 bed?

For a 200x210 bed, the basics are simple: the fitted sheet should match your mattress size. Always check the mattress height too. Especially with a large double bed, the corner height makes a big difference in how snug the sheet stays.

So keep an eye on:

  • Length and width - pick a fitted sheet that fits 200x210 cm.
  • Corner height - important for tall mattresses or extra toppers.
  • Mattress type - a standard mattress, topper, or added protection with a molton each call for a different sheet.
  • Elastic fit - helps keep the sheet neatly in place.

Do you use a topper on your mattress? Then a regular fitted sheet isn’t always the best choice. In that case, look for a fitted sheet made for the topper itself, so it lies smoother and shifts less.

Which material suits your sleep comfort best?

The right material doesn’t just decide how soft your bed feels, it also affects how practical the sheet is day to day. The HappyBed offers fitted sheets in multiple options, so you can choose based on feel, comfort, and care.

Cotton jersey

Cotton jersey is a popular pick if you want a soft, stretchy, and comfy sheet. The fabric feels pleasant, has gentle give, and usually hugs the mattress nicely. For many sleepers, it’s a great all-round choice for everyday use.

Velvet

Velvet feels extra soft and warm. This type of sheet is perfect if you love a cozy, luxurious sleep vibe. Many people choose this fabric in colder months for its snug feel.

Muslin

Muslin has a light and soft character. It’s a good match if you like a relaxed, comfortable look and a fluid, breathable feel in bed.

Molton

You mainly use a molton fitted sheet as an extra protective layer for your mattress. It’s handy if you want to keep your mattress fresher for longer and add protection under your regular sheet.

What stays put best on a 200x210 mattress?

With large mattresses, a good fit matters even more. The bigger the surface, the sooner you’ll notice if a sheet is too loose. A fitted sheet with elastic edging helps it wrap the mattress better and stay smooth.

If you want your sheet to stay in place as well as possible, check:

  • The right size - too roomy means more creasing and shifting.
  • Enough stretch - especially nice with jersey.
  • Matching corner height - essential for tall mattresses or extra toppers.
  • Layer-specific use - for a topper, it’s best to choose a separate topper fitted sheet.

A snug fitted sheet not only sleeps better, it also makes your bed look tidier and more calming.

Is a regular fitted sheet suitable for a 200x210 topper?

Not always. A topper often has a different height and needs a tighter fit. If you only want to cover the topper, a special topper fitted sheet is usually more practical than a standard one.
